Dyspnea, or breathlessness, is a common clinical symptom encountered in various medical settings. It is often a manifestation of underlying cardiovascular or pulmonary diseases, but can also be due to non-physiological factors. The challenge lies in deciphering the cause of dyspnea and providing effective management strategies.
Dyspnea arises from a complex interplay between peripheral and central mechanisms. The primary drivers include mechanical factors, chemoreceptor stimulation, and cognitive perception of breathing effort. Conditions such as chronic obstructive pulmonary disease (COPD), heart failure, and pulmonary embolism often result in dyspnea due to these mechanisms.
A comprehensive history and physical examination are crucial in the evaluation of a breathless patient. The onset, duration, and triggers of dyspnea provide valuable clues. Objective measures such as spirometry and arterial blood gas analysis can further aid in diagnosis. Imaging modalities and invasive tests should be considered based on the clinical suspicion of underlying diseases.
Management of dyspnea should be directed towards the underlying cause. In COPD, bronchodilators and steroids are the mainstay, while in heart failure, diuretics and ACE inhibitors are often beneficial. Non-pharmacological interventions such as pulmonary rehabilitation and oxygen therapy can also be useful. In some cases, addressing psychological factors may alleviate dyspnea.
Unraveling the breathless patient requires a thorough understanding of the pathophysiology of dyspnea and a systematic clinical approach. The goal is to identify the underlying cause and implement appropriate management strategies. This not only improves the patient's quality of life but also reduces healthcare utilization. As clinicians, we should strive for a holistic approach, considering both physiological and non-physiological factors, in managing dyspnea.
